当前位置: 首页 > news >正文

Speechless:无需登录的微博内容永久保存方案

Speechless:无需登录的微博内容永久保存方案

【免费下载链接】Speechless把新浪微博的内容,导出成 PDF 文件进行备份的 Chrome Extension。项目地址: https://gitcode.com/gh_mirrors/sp/Speechless

在数字信息快速流动的时代,社交媒体内容如同沙滩上的足迹,随时可能被潮水抹去。对于微博用户而言,那些记录生活点滴、分享专业见解、珍藏重要时刻的内容,往往在平台算法调整或账号异常时面临消失的风险。Speechless Chrome扩展应运而生,它提供了一个无需登录、安全高效的微博内容备份方案,让每一段数字记忆都能被永久保存。

为什么微博内容需要本地备份?

微博作为中国最大的社交媒体平台之一,承载着数亿用户的数字生活。然而,这些内容面临着多重风险:平台政策变化可能导致内容被限制或删除;账号安全问题可能让你失去访问权限;服务器迁移或维护可能导致历史数据丢失。更重要的是,许多有价值的讨论、重要的信息记录、珍贵的个人回忆都存储在云端,缺乏本地备份。

Speechless解决了这一痛点,它采用了一种巧妙的技术方案:通过浏览器扩展直接与微博网页交互,无需API密钥或登录凭证,就能将公开的微博内容转换为格式化的PDF文档。这种方式既保护了用户隐私,又确保了备份的完整性。

三步完成微博内容永久存档

第一步:安装与配置

Speechless的安装过程极其简单。在Chrome浏览器中搜索Speechless扩展,点击添加即可完成安装。安装后,浏览器工具栏会出现Speechless的图标,表示扩展已准备就绪。这个轻量级扩展基于现代前端技术栈构建,使用了Vue3和TailwindCSS,确保界面响应迅速且用户体验流畅。

第二步:内容筛选与定制

打开你想要备份的微博页面后,点击Speechless图标,会弹出配置面板。这里提供了多个实用选项:

  • 时间范围选择:通过直观的日历控件,你可以精确选择要备份的时间段,比如仅备份2023年的内容,或备份特定月份的微博
  • 内容类型过滤:可以选择仅备份原创内容,或者包含转发的完整时间线
  • 图片质量设置:根据备份目的选择高清原图或压缩版本,平衡文件大小与画质需求

这些配置选项通过src/component/目录下的组件实现,如SelectMonth.vueSelectTimeRange.vue,提供了用户友好的交互界面。

第三步:一键生成与导出

确认设置后,点击开始备份按钮。Speechless会在后台自动执行以下操作:

  1. 识别目标用户的UID并获取可访问的微博列表
  2. 按时间范围筛选符合条件的微博内容
  3. 逐条获取微博的完整信息,包括文字、图片和表情
  4. 将内容按照美观的排版格式添加到临时页面中
  5. 触发浏览器的打印预览功能,将页面内容保存为PDF

整个过程完全在本地浏览器中完成,你的微博账号信息不会被传输到任何第三方服务器。

四大核心应用场景深度解析

个人数字资产归档

对于普通用户,Speechless是个人数字资产管理的得力工具。你可以:

  • 年度回顾:每年年底备份全年微博,创建个人年度数字年鉴
  • 重要事件存档:保存婚礼、旅行、毕业等重要时刻的图文记录
  • 成长轨迹记录:备份个人思想变化、技能成长的过程记录

专业内容创作者的工作流优化

内容创作者可以将Speechless整合到自己的工作流中:

  • 内容素材库建设:将优质微博内容备份为本地素材库,便于后续创作参考
  • 竞品分析资料收集:定期备份行业大V的微博内容,分析其内容策略和用户互动模式
  • 作品集整理:将自己在微博上的创作成果整理成PDF作品集,用于个人展示或求职

学术研究者的数据采集方案

研究人员可以利用Speechless进行社交媒体数据采集:

  • 社会现象研究:备份特定话题下的微博讨论,进行内容分析和趋势研究
  • 舆论监测:定期备份相关账号的微博内容,建立舆论变化的时间序列数据
  • 案例研究资料收集:将微博上的典型案例备份为研究材料

企业社交媒体管理者的合规工具

企业社交媒体管理人员可以使用Speechless:

  • 合规备份:定期备份官方微博内容,满足内容存档的合规要求
  • 危机管理资料:备份重要声明和危机应对内容,建立完整的沟通记录
  • 团队交接材料:将社交媒体运营历史备份为交接文档

技术实现背后的设计哲学

Speechless的技术实现体现了"简单即美"的设计理念。项目采用模块化架构,核心功能分布在src/module/目录中:

  • blogPost.js负责微博内容的获取和处理逻辑
  • pageHandle.js管理页面交互和状态控制
  • range.js处理时间范围筛选功能

扩展利用Chrome浏览器自带的打印功能实现PDF导出,这种设计避免了复杂的PDF生成库依赖,使扩展体积保持在最小。同时,所有数据处理都在用户本地浏览器中完成,确保了数据隐私和安全。

项目使用Vue3构建用户界面,通过响应式设计提供流畅的交互体验。TailwindCSS确保了界面风格的一致性和可定制性。整个技术栈的选择都围绕着"轻量、高效、易维护"的原则。

高级使用技巧与最佳实践

高效备份策略

为了获得最佳备份体验,建议采用以下策略:

  1. 分时段备份:不要一次性备份多年的内容,而是按月或按季度分批处理,这样既避免了单次操作时间过长,也便于后续管理
  2. 分类存储:为不同类型的微博内容创建不同的PDF文件,如"个人生活"、"专业分享"、"兴趣爱好"等类别
  3. 命名规范:采用"用户名_年份_月份_类型"的命名规则,便于快速查找和整理

文件管理与优化

备份后的PDF文件管理同样重要:

  • 压缩存储:对于主要用于存档的备份文件,可以使用PDF压缩工具进一步减小文件体积
  • 云端同步:将备份的PDF文件同步到云存储服务,实现双重备份
  • 定期检查:每年检查一次备份文件的完整性和可读性

与其他工具集成

Speechless可以与其他工具结合使用,构建更完整的内容管理方案:

  • 使用文档管理软件(如Notion、Obsidian)对备份内容进行二次整理和标注
  • 结合OCR工具,将PDF中的图片文字转换为可搜索的文本
  • 使用自动化脚本定期执行备份任务,实现完全自动化的微博存档

常见问题与解决方案

备份过程中断怎么办?

如果备份过程因网络问题或其他原因中断,Speechless支持断点续传。重新打开微博页面并启动备份,扩展会从上次中断的位置继续,避免重复下载已获取的内容。

如何确保图片完整备份?

微博使用懒加载技术延迟加载图片。在开始备份前,建议先滚动浏览目标时间段的所有微博,确保所有图片都已加载完成。Speechless也内置了重试机制,会自动尝试重新获取加载失败的图片。

备份的文件太大如何处理?

对于包含大量高清图片的微博内容,生成的PDF文件可能较大。解决方案包括:

  • 在备份设置中选择"压缩图片"选项
  • 按更小的时间段分批备份
  • 使用PDF优化工具对生成的PDF进行二次压缩

可以备份私密账号的内容吗?

Speechless只能备份公开可见的微博内容。这是出于对用户隐私的尊重和技术限制的考虑。私密账号的内容受到微博平台保护,无法通过公开接口获取。

未来发展方向与社区贡献

Speechless作为一个开源项目,欢迎社区贡献和功能建议。项目代码托管在GitCode平台,开发者可以通过以下命令获取源码:

git clone https://gitcode.com/gh_mirrors/sp/Speechless

项目未来的发展方向可能包括:

  • 支持更多社交媒体平台的备份功能
  • 增加导出格式选项(如Markdown、HTML)
  • 开发桌面客户端版本
  • 添加智能分类和标签功能

开始你的数字记忆保护之旅

在数字时代,我们的记忆越来越多地存储在云端平台。Speechless提供了一个简单而有效的解决方案,将这些数字记忆转化为可以永久保存的本地文件。无论你是想保存珍贵的个人回忆,还是需要备份重要的专业内容,Speechless都能成为你可靠的数字资产管理工具。

现在就开始使用Speechless,给你的微博内容加上一道安全锁,确保那些重要的文字、图片和情感永远不会因为平台变化或技术故障而消失。每一段数字记忆都值得被认真对待,每一份内容都值得被永久保存。

![Speechless微博备份工具界面](https://raw.gitcode.com/gh_mirrors/sp/Speechless/raw/21e4aabdedc3509755754dd9e5880e50d647f215/medias/Small promo tile.png?utm_source=gitcode_repo_files)

Speechless:让你的微博内容不再"无言",每一段记忆都有处安放

【免费下载链接】Speechless把新浪微博的内容,导出成 PDF 文件进行备份的 Chrome Extension。项目地址: https://gitcode.com/gh_mirrors/sp/Speechless

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.gsyq.cn/news/1502112.html

相关文章:

  • 格图凸轮滚子转台维修成本高不高? - mypinpai
  • 别再被TensorBoard的Smoothing骗了!手把手教你正确解读GAN训练中的Loss曲线(附真实案例)
  • 不只是建个文件夹!深入NuGet包解析机制,彻底搞懂MSB4018错误的来龙去脉
  • Visual Studio 2019编译报错MSB4018?别慌,手把手教你定位并修复那个神秘的NuGet回退文件夹
  • 2026 淮安彩钢瓦修缮 TOP4 权威推荐(全区域服务) - 本地便民网
  • 用Pygame和DQN复刻经典AI实验:手把手教你从零搭建自己的Wumpus世界(Python 3.7环境)
  • 5分钟掌握跨平台媒体压缩:CompressO的零配置高效工作流
  • 2026 扬州彩钢瓦修缮 TOP4 权威推荐(全区域服务・适配高湿梅雨) - 本地便民网
  • 为什么你的下一个项目需要FlipClock.js?7个实战场景告诉你答案
  • 数据的加密与解密(05:49)
  • 2026山西冲击钻及钻探设备供应商推荐榜:山西喷浆机、山西坑道钻机、山西履带式切顶钻机、山西张拉机具、山西扩孔钻头选择指南 - 优质品牌商家
  • 烟台黄金回收五大靠谱商家实测2026年6月 - 余生黄金回收
  • 可视耳勺方便吗?可视挖耳勺怎么连接?可视挖耳勺的正确使用方法
  • LTspice仿真ZVS振荡器死活不起振?试试这个瞬态参数设置,亲测有效!
  • ZenTimings终极指南:免费解锁AMD Ryzen内存时序监控与超频优化工具
  • BM3D图像去噪Python工具包:含编译模块、多噪声测试与即用示例
  • QOwnNotes实战指南:开源Markdown笔记本如何彻底改变你的知识管理方式
  • 如何快速掌握SMUDebugTool:AMD Ryzen系统调试的终极指南
  • Xilinx FPGA上可直接编译的PCI 2.2接口IP核完整工程(含bit文件与调试日志)
  • SpringMVC 入门到实战 简介和入门案例 01-13
  • 如何高效使用Mootdx:Python通达信数据接口实战指南
  • Java开发进阶之路:掌握面向对象编程的精髓
  • 3PEAK思瑞浦 TPA5561U-S5TR SOT23-5 运算放大器
  • 2023年3月技术断面图:LLM落地、Chiplet封装与Rust系统编程的收敛点
  • 用MATLAB复现战斗部破片飞散仿真:从Gurney公式到矢量图绘制(附完整代码)
  • FlicFlac音频转换引擎深度拆解:轻量级架构与专业级技术实现
  • 3种终极方案:免费解锁加密音乐文件的完整指南
  • 3步永久保存微信聊天记录:从数据丢失到数字资产管理的完整指南
  • 三步永久保存微信聊天记录:你的数字记忆守护者
  • Python开发工具链全解析:IDE、调试器与版本控制